OP's son Peter (31M) is marrying Ellie (29F) soon. OP finds Ellie distant and unfriendly, with concerns about her behavior.
RedditWhen Peter and Ellie began dating, Ellie visited for weekends, cooking dinner with Peter at OP's house but rarely inviting her to join.

The Importance of Communication
Effective communication is essential for managing conflicts during wedding planning.
According to research from the Journal of Family Psychology, couples who practice active listening and empathy are better equipped to resolve disagreements.
When both partners feel heard, it fosters a sense of unity and collaboration in navigating familial pressures.
